WorkspaceServiceHelper.GetServiceAsync<T>(IWorkspace, Boolean) Yöntem

Tanım

Zaman uyumsuz model kullanarak çalışma alanından hizmet türü al

public static System.Threading.Tasks.Task<T> GetServiceAsync<T> (this Microsoft.VisualStudio.Workspace.IWorkspace workspace, bool throwIfNotFound = false) where T : class;
static member GetServiceAsync : Microsoft.VisualStudio.Workspace.IWorkspace * bool -> System.Threading.Tasks.Task<'T (requires 'T : null)> (requires 'T : null)
<Extension()>
Public Function GetServiceAsync(Of T As Class) (workspace As IWorkspace, Optional throwIfNotFound As Boolean = false) As Task(Of T)

Tür Parametreleri

T

Sorulacak hizmetin türü

Parametreler

workspace
IWorkspace

Çalışma alanı bağlamı

throwIfNotFound
Boolean

Hizmet bulunamazsa özel durum oluştur

Döndürülenler

Task<T>

Çalışma alanı hizmeti veya bulunmazsa null

Şunlara uygulanır